CompositionContext.GetExport Méthode
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Surcharges
GetExport(CompositionContract) |
Récupère l’exportation qui correspond au contrat spécifié. |
GetExport(Type) |
Récupère l’exportation qui correspond au type spécifié. |
GetExport(Type, String) |
Récupère l’exportation qui correspond au nom et au type spécifiés. |
GetExport<TExport>() |
Récupère l’exportation qui correspond au paramètre de type générique spécifié. |
GetExport<TExport>(String) |
Récupère l’exportation qui correspond au nom de contrat et au paramètre de type générique. |
GetExport(CompositionContract)
- Source:
- CompositionContext.cs
- Source:
- CompositionContext.cs
- Source:
- CompositionContext.cs
Récupère l’exportation qui correspond au contrat spécifié.
public:
System::Object ^ GetExport(System::Composition::Hosting::Core::CompositionContract ^ contract);
public object GetExport (System.Composition.Hosting.Core.CompositionContract contract);
member this.GetExport : System.Composition.Hosting.Core.CompositionContract -> obj
Public Function GetExport (contract As CompositionContract) As Object
Paramètres
- contract
- CompositionContract
Contrat à faire correspondre.
Retours
Valeur exportée.
Exceptions
Aucune exportation n’a été trouvée pour contract
.
S’applique à
GetExport(Type)
- Source:
- CompositionContext.cs
- Source:
- CompositionContext.cs
- Source:
- CompositionContext.cs
Récupère l’exportation qui correspond au type spécifié.
public:
System::Object ^ GetExport(Type ^ exportType);
public object GetExport (Type exportType);
member this.GetExport : Type -> obj
Public Function GetExport (exportType As Type) As Object
Paramètres
- exportType
- Type
Type à trouver.
Retours
Valeur exportée.
Exceptions
Aucune exportation n’a été trouvée pour exportType
.
S’applique à
GetExport(Type, String)
- Source:
- CompositionContext.cs
- Source:
- CompositionContext.cs
- Source:
- CompositionContext.cs
Récupère l’exportation qui correspond au nom et au type spécifiés.
public:
System::Object ^ GetExport(Type ^ exportType, System::String ^ contractName);
public object GetExport (Type exportType, string contractName);
member this.GetExport : Type * string -> obj
Public Function GetExport (exportType As Type, contractName As String) As Object
Paramètres
- exportType
- Type
Type à trouver.
- contractName
- String
Nom à mettre en correspondance.
Retours
Valeur exportée.
Exceptions
Aucune exportation n’a été trouvée pour exportType
et contractName
.
S’applique à
GetExport<TExport>()
- Source:
- CompositionContext.cs
- Source:
- CompositionContext.cs
- Source:
- CompositionContext.cs
Récupère l’exportation qui correspond au paramètre de type générique spécifié.
public:
generic <typename TExport>
TExport GetExport();
public TExport GetExport<TExport> ();
member this.GetExport : unit -> 'Export
Public Function GetExport(Of TExport) () As TExport
Paramètres de type
- TExport
Type à trouver.
Retours
Valeur exportée.
Exceptions
Aucune exportation n’a été trouvée pour TExport
.
S’applique à
GetExport<TExport>(String)
- Source:
- CompositionContext.cs
- Source:
- CompositionContext.cs
- Source:
- CompositionContext.cs
Récupère l’exportation qui correspond au nom de contrat et au paramètre de type générique.
public:
generic <typename TExport>
TExport GetExport(System::String ^ contractName);
public TExport GetExport<TExport> (string contractName);
member this.GetExport : string -> 'Export
Public Function GetExport(Of TExport) (contractName As String) As TExport
Paramètres de type
- TExport
Type à trouver.
Paramètres
- contractName
- String
Nom à mettre en correspondance.
Retours
Valeur exportée.
Exceptions
Aucune exportation n’a été trouvée pour TExport
et contractName
.